63 Pakistani terror suspects moved out of Gitmo prison

Lahore, Apr. 18 (ANI): Most of the Pakistani terror suspects, who were held at the Guantanamo Bay Detention Camp, have been shifted back to Pakistan, the New York Times claims.

Out of 71 Pakistanis imprisoned at the infamous detention camp, 63 have been shifted back to Pakistan, while eight are still languishing there.

Abdul Rehman, Ali Abdul Aziz, Majid Khan, Saifullah Paracha and Khalid Sheikh Muhammad were amongst the eight Pakistanis who were still detained at Guantanamo Bay, the report said.

Muhammad is considered to be the mastermind of the 9/11 attacks on the US.

Citing a US Defense Department prisoners' list, the report said that initially, 779 were brought to the prison prisoners from 49 countries. 533 of them have been shifted to their countries while 241 were still languishing in Guantanamo. (ANI)
